Quick Answer
A pole barn woodworking shop needs 10-12 foot ceiling height, 200+ amp electrical for machinery, comprehensive dust collection system (2-5 HP collector with 4-inch ductwork), strategically placed 220V outlets for major machines, organized workflow zones (rough lumber prep, machine processing, assembly, finishing), natural plus LED lighting (80+ foot candles at work surfaces), and humidity control for wood storage. Plan for 400-600 sq ft per serious woodworker with machine access from all sides.

Dust Collection
Collector Sizing
- Small Shop (1-2 machines): 1.5-2 HP single-stage
- Medium Shop (3-5 machines): 2-3 HP two-stage
- Large Shop (6+ machines): 3-5 HP two-stage cyclone
Ductwork Design
- Main Duct: 6-8 inch diameter
- Branch Ducts: 4 inch to each machine
- Blast Gates: At each machine to control suction
- Runs: Keep runs as short and straight as possible
- Schedule 40 Pipe: PVC or metal for ductwork
Air Filtration
- Air Cleaner: Ceiling-mounted unit for fine dust
- Location: Center of shop, away from walls
- CFM Rating: 400-800 CFM for typical shops
- Run Time: 30-60 minutes after shop use
Electrical Planning
Service Size
- 100 Amp: Small shop, limited machines
- 200 Amp: Recommended for serious shop
- 400 Amp: Large shop, multiple heavy machines
Circuit Planning
- 220V Outlets: For table saw, jointer, planer, dust collector
- Dedicated Circuits: For major machines (avoid tripping)
- 110V Outlets: Every 4-6 feet around perimeter
- Ceiling Outlets: For task lighting, air cleaner
- Future Expansion: Add extra circuits for tools you may add
Machine Layout
Table Saw
- Position for infeed and outfeed of sheet goods
- Allow 8+ feet in front and back for 4x8 sheets
- Consider outfeed table or roller stand
- Natural light from side windows helps visibility
Jointer and Planer
- Position near each other in workflow
- Allow 6-8 feet for long board processing
- Consider back-to-back layout for space efficiency
- Infeed/outfeed space for each machine

Lighting
Natural Light
- Windows: Place on north side if possible (consistent light)
- Skypanels: For diffused natural light
- Awning Windows: High windows for ventilation and light
Artificial Lighting
- LED High Bays: For general illumination
- Task Lighting: Over workbench, machines
- Light Level: 80+ foot candles at work surfaces
- Color Temperature: 4000-5000K for accurate color rendering
- CRI: 90+ CRI for color-critical work
Climate Control
Humidity Management
- Ideal RH: 40-60% for wood storage
- Dehumidifier: Essential in humid climates
- Humidifier: In very dry climates
- Monitoring: Hygrometer to track humidity
Temperature
- Comfortable Range: 65-75°F for working
- Finishing: 70°F ideal for glue, finish application
- Finishes: Temperature affects dry times

Expert Tips
After building dozens of woodworking shops, we've learned that dust collection is not optional—it's essential for your health and the quality of your work. Invest in a proper cyclone collector with 4-inch ducts to each machine. And add a ceiling-mounted air cleaner to catch the fine dust that escapes the collector.
Also, plan your machine layout before running electrical. You want 220V drops at each machine location, and lots of 110V outlets throughout. Putting conduit in the concrete slab before pouring saves a lot of trenching later.
Common Questions
Q: How big should a woodworking shop be?
A: For a serious hobbyist, 800-1,200 sq ft is ideal. This allows room for all major machines with adequate working space around each. 400-600 sq ft works for a smaller shop but requires careful planning and compact machines.
Q: What size dust collector do I need?
A: For a 2-3 machine shop, a 2 HP collector is adequate. For 4-6 machines, step up to a 3 HP two-stage unit. For larger shops with multiple machines running simultaneously, a 5 HP cyclone is recommended. Ductwork design is as important as collector size.
Q: How much electrical service do I need?
A> 200 amp service is recommended for most shops. This provides enough capacity for multiple 220V machines, lighting, and future expansion. Small shops with basic tools may get by with 100 amps.
Q: Should I heat and cool my woodworking shop?
A> Climate control is highly recommended. Temperature affects how glue and finishes cure, and humidity affects wood stability. Plus, you'll be more comfortable year-round. Mini-split systems are efficient and provide both heating and cooling.
